matlab plot点
时间: 2023-09-21 15:10:26 浏览: 42
您好!在MATLAB中,要绘制散点图,可以使用plot函数。您可以按照以下步骤进行操作:
1. 创建两个数组,分别表示点的横坐标和纵坐标。例如,x = [1, 2, 3, 4] 和 y = [5, 7, 2, 6]。
2. 使用plot函数来绘制散点图。将数组x和y作为参数传递给plot函数,如 plot(x, y, 'o')。
这里的 'o' 参数表示绘制圆形的散点图,您也可以选择其他符号,比如'.'代表绘制小圆点。
3. 添加标题和轴标签,以提高图形的可读性。使用title、xlabel和ylabel函数来完成这些设置。
4. 可选地,您还可以添加网格线、调整坐标轴范围等其他自定义设置,以满足您的需求。
下面是一个示例代码:
```matlab
x = [1, 2, 3, 4];
y = [5, 7, 2, 6];
plot(x, y, 'o')
title('Scatter Plot')
xlabel('X-axis')
ylabel('Y-axis')
grid on
```
请注意,这只是一个简单的示例代码,您可以根据自己的数据和需求进行相应的修改。希望对您有帮助!如果有任何其他问题,
相关问题
matlab plot点格式
在Matlab的plot函数中,可以使用可选参数来控制数据点的格式。下面是一些常用的点格式:
1. 颜色:使用颜色缩写表示数据点的颜色,例如'r'表示红色,'b'表示蓝色,'g'表示绿色,'k'表示黑色,'y'表示黄色等。
2. 标记:使用标记代码来指定数据点的形状,例如'+'表示加号标记,'o'表示圆圈标记,'s'表示正方形标记,'^'表示三角形标记等。
3. 大小:使用数字来指定数据点的大小,例如10表示10个像素的大小。
下面是一个例子,使用红色圆圈绘制正弦曲线的数据点,并将点的大小设置为10:
```
x = 0:0.1:2*pi;
y = sin(x);
plot(x,y,'ro','MarkerSize',10);
```
这将绘制一个红色圆圈表示正弦曲线的数据点,点的大小为10个像素。
matlabplot定位点
在Matlab中,您可以使用plot函数来绘制图形和定位点。通过指定x和y坐标的向量,您可以在图中标记出特定的定位点。例如,您可以使用以下代码在图中绘制一个定位点:
x = [1, 2, 3, 4];
y = [10, 5, 8, 12];
plot(x, y, 'ro');
这将在图中以红色的圆形标记出x和y向量对应的坐标点。
如果您想要自定义刻度和刻度标签,可以使用set函数来设置坐标轴属性。例如,您可以使用以下代码来设置x轴的刻度和标签为空:
set(gca, 'xtick', []);
set(gca, 'xticklabel', []);
这将移除x轴上的刻度和标签。
另外,如果您想要使用Latex格式化刻度标签,您需要从Matlab文件交换中心下载一个函数。这个函数将允许您在刻度标签中使用Latex语法来实现更高级的格式化。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[Matlab绘制XTickLabel有效字符串(Matlab Plot XTickLabel valid strings)](https://blog.csdn.net/weixin_34405769/article/details/115811855)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]